One-of-a-kind opportunity to purchase a park-like estate spanning over 2.1 acres across two of LA's most coveted neighborhoods - Pacific Palisades' Riviera and Brentwood's Sullivan Canyon. A vast departure from the busy L.A. lifestyle, the lovely post-and-beam farmhouse with a celebrity pedigree is nestled beyond gates and tucked away from the road. The property features abundant privacy, an enchanting grassy meadow hidden amongst majestic old-growth Oak Trees, mesmerizing views of the hills and canyons, meandering nature paths, resort-like pool and spa, potential for equestrian use, and private driveway access from both San Remo Dr and Old Ranch Rd. The home blends an authentic farmhouse style with modern amenities. Its gourmet kitchen includes center island w/ seating, breakfast room, fireplace, and spacious pantry, and leads to the comfortable living spaces. A large family room and dining area with custom built-ins look out over the verdant surroundings. Retreat to the primary suite, which encompasses an entire floor, and boasts a peaceful bedroom with fireplace, walk-in closet, spa-like bathroom with fireplace, dry sauna, study/den, and private balcony. There are four additional bedrooms, a secondary family room with kitchenette, dedicated laundry room, and a sizable storage area/archive room with separate access. The price of $15,000,000 includes both 1710 San Remo Dr and the land at 1761 Old Ranch Rd, and the properties are listed separately as well, see MLS #24-454101 for San Remo and MLS #24-454129 for Old Ranch.

The ultimate hideaway for extraordinary estates and high-end residences, the Pacific Palisades is one of Los Angeles’ highly coveted neighborhoods and best-kept secrets. With views of the ocean, beach access, and close proximity to Santa Monica, Malibu, Brentwood and Topanga without the traffic, Pacific Palisades is the perfect place to call home. The charming tight-knit community and secluded location surrounded by lush greenery and coastal views, the thriving community attracts established professionals and families.
Potential home buyers can enjoy chic traditional estates with ocean vistas, dramatic architectural residences, custom-built compounds and welcoming homes near Palisades Village, or popular neighborhoods such as the Riviera, Brentwood Park, and the Huntington.
Pacific Palisades is also home to the striking Getty Villa as well as numerous breathtaking parks offering access to some of Los Angeles’ finest hiking trails, including Will Rogers State Park, Topanga Canyon State Park, Palisades Park, and more.
Having undoubtedly emerged as a market to be reckoned with, Pacific Palisades’ average sales price enjoyed a 21% increase in the past three years. The average price per square foot of a home surpassed previous years at $993, and it’s now been ten consecutive quarters of that figure surpassing the $900 mark.
